What CJC-1295 (No DAC) + Ipamorelin does

The two halves reach the same pituitary cell through different receptors: the CJC-1295 backbone is a GHRH-receptor agonist, ipamorelin an agonist at the ghrelin receptor GHS-R1a. The case for pairing the classes is that a GHRH analogue plus a growth-hormone-releasing peptide produces a synergistic pulse, which was shown with GHRP-2 in 47 men rather than with ipamorelin. Ipamorelin's distinguishing property is selectivity: it matched GHRP-6 on growth hormone release while, unlike GHRP-6 and GHRP-2, leaving ACTH and cortisol no higher than GHRH did — measured in conscious swine. Every human growth-hormone and IGF-I number published under the CJC-1295 name belongs to the albumin-binding DAC form, a different molecule from the no-DAC peptide in this blend, which raised growth hormone 2- to 10-fold and IGF-I 1.5- to 3-fold against placebo in healthy adults. Ipamorelin was well tolerated in a 114-patient phase 2 trial after bowel surgery, with adverse events in 87.5% of the treated group against 94.8% on placebo, and reviews of this peptide class report prolactin and cortisol elevation, appetite change and dysglycaemia, fluid retention, joint and muscle aches and injection-site reactions.

What the research reports8 findings · 16 sources · 4 from clinical trials

The human GH and IGF-I data published under the CJC-1295 name come from the albumin-binding DAC form, not the no-DAC constituent in this blend: in two randomised, double-blind, placebo-controlled ascending-dose trials in healthy adults aged 21 to 61, a single subcutaneous injection produced dose-dependent increases in mean plasma GH of 2- to 10-fold for 6 days or more and in mean plasma IGF-I of 1.5- to 3-fold for 9 to 11 days, with an estimated half-life of 5.8 to 8.1 days; after multiple doses mean IGF-I remained above baseline for up to 28 days.8

Clinical trial28 and 49 dayshealthy adults aged 21-61, two randomised placebo-controlled double-blind ascending-dose trials of CJC-1295 with DAC

In healthy men aged 20 to 40 sampled every 20 minutes across a 12-hour overnight window, a single injection of CJC-1295 with DAC given one week earlier raised trough GH 7.5-fold (P < 0.0001), mean GH 46% (P < 0.01) and IGF-I 45% (P < 0.001) against each man's own pre-injection profile, with GH pulse frequency and magnitude unchanged. This was uncontrolled, with no placebo arm.9

Clinical trialsingle injection, reassessed at 1 weekhealthy men aged 20-40, uncontrolled within-subject before/after overnight 12-hour GH pulsatility sampling

In healthy male volunteers given 15-minute intravenous ipamorelin infusions at five ascending dose levels with eight men per level, kinetics were dose-proportional, with a terminal half-life of 2 hours, clearance of 0.078 L/h/kg and steady-state volume of distribution of 0.22 L/kg; a single episode of GH release peaked at 0.67 hours, and half-maximal GH stimulation (SC50) occurred at 214 nmol/L.10

Clinical trialsingle 15-minute infusionhealthy male volunteers, dose-escalation pharmacokinetic-pharmacodynamic study with eight men at each of five infusion doses
